Santa Fe, Texas: James Arnold Burch, 80, died on Saturday, May 21, 2022, surrounded by his loving family in Texas City, Texas. James was born November 7, 1941, in Winnfield, Louisiana. He graduated from Texas City High School in 1960 and enlisted in the US Air Force in June of 1960. He proudly served his country for 6 years. After serving in the Air Force, he began working for El Paso Natural Gas in Dumas, Texas and later for Union Carbide/Dow in Texas City for over 25 years. He owned and operated Burch A/C and Heating for over 50 years. He also refereed high school football for 30 years. If he wasn't working or with his family, he was in his boat fishing, camping with his wife, Susan, or at the deer lease with his son, grandkids, and son-in-law. He was a loving husband to his wife, Susan, for over 47 years, and they were always together. He was a wonderful Dad, PawPaw, and Great Grandpa, always there for anything his kids or grandkids needed. He was preceded in death by his parents, Arnold Roy and Lurline Avert (Walker) Burch; brothers, Jerry Malone and Lloyd Burch; sister, Geraldine Burch; aunt and uncle, Edith and W.T. Hammock; mother-in-law, Evelyn Whearley. He was survived by his loving wife of nearly 48 years, Susan Burch; son, Jim Burch and wife Laura; daughters, Lauri Arnold and husband Conrad, Sheri Tisdel, Rachael Renz and husband Jason; father-in-law, J.B. Whearley; sister-in-law, Donna Kellow and husband Ray; cousins, Linda Gibson, Pat Walker and wife Cindy; grandchildren, Colby, Ashley, Hunter, Reese, Daniel, Kaitlyn, Lucas, Andrea, Randy, Samantha, Josh; and 11 great-grandchildren. Services were held at 12:00 p.m. on Wednesday, 25 May, in the chapel of Hayes Funeral Home, with Pastor Kevin Garber officiating.
